About the facility Fifth Season Residential

At Fifth Season, our facility design is smaller, in order to provide unique Personal Lifestyle Programs that are intended to instill a feeling of self worth and value to our residents. Specifically, our programming is designed to provide quality of life and slow the aging process. Alzheimer's care, exercise, interactive music therapy, beauty salon experiences, mental stimulation, and socialization...all combine to create the Fifth Season experience. Our staff focuses on what our residents can do, rather than what they cannot. We believe that in spite of aging, an older adult still has a world to experience...and we are there to support them.

Excellent care of my mom

Mom was struggling with loneliness and depression after Dad died. She moved into the Fifth Season Marion IL in 2017 and quickly made friends. Her health improved and she was treated like family by the staff. The meals were delicious and we were glad to see her gain back some of the weight she had lost. I am so grateful to Fifth Season for giving Mom a wonderful life there. She passed away in 2019 otherwise she would still be living in her apartment there. I highly recommend this company to anyone looking.

Frequently Asked Questions about Fifth Season Residential

Fifth Season Residential offers Studio and 1 Bedroom. Learn more.

A Place for Mom has scored Fifth Season Residential 9 out of 10 using our proprietary review score.

We assign review scores to give a more reliable view into senior living communities and home care agencies. Our review scores prioritize reviews that are recent — the past 24 months — because we know families need current information when choosing senior care.

Those with many recent, positive reviews receive a high review score, while providers with few recent reviews — regardless of how positive — receive a lower review score. Communities with no recent reviews will not have a review score, even if older reviews are positive. The maximum A Place for Mom review score a community can receive is 10 points.
